LimX Dynamics Transitions to POC Deployment with Luna Humanoid and COSA Brain System

LimX Dynamics has shifted its focus from showcasing motion control technologies to deploying proof of concepts (POCs) with its Luna humanoid robot, COSA brain system, and FluxVLA Engine. This transition highlights a significant industry trend where attention is moving from theoretical capabilities to practical applications in real-world scenarios.

This shift is crucial as it indicates a growing demand for humanoid robots that can effectively operate in various environments. The emphasis on deployment suggests that companies are prioritizing the development of robots that can perform specific tasks reliably, which is essential for gaining traction in the market.

Looking ahead, it will be important to monitor how LimX Dynamics and other players in the industry adapt their technologies to meet the practical needs of users. No further timeline was disclosed at the time of publication.
